SUBSCRIBE TO OUR CHANNEL: https://goo.gl/lWwBcJ Professor Tomio Kikuchi, 90, is a living legend of macrobiotics in Brazil. His restaurant, Satori, serves only meals based on a diet that emphasizes the importance of whole grains, vegetables, and legumes. The place is a discreet gem in downtown São Paulo, located on the mezzanine of an old building in Liberdade. Trip TV went there to understand what one of the main representatives of macrobiotics in the country preaches.
